The Gigabyte GP-GSTFS31120GNT 120GB averaged 23.3% lower than the peak scores attained by the group leaders. This is an excellent result which ranks the Gigabyte GP-GSTFS31120GNT 120GB near the top of the comparison list.

Strengths

Avg. 4K-64Thread Mixed IO Speed 160MB/s
Avg. 4K Random Read Speed 35.3MB/s

Above average consistency

The range of scores (95th - 5th percentile) for the Gigabyte GP-GSTFS31120GNT 120GB is 34.3%. This is a relatively narrow range which indicates that the Gigabyte GP-GSTFS31120GNT 120GB performs reasonably consistently under varying real world conditions.

Weaknesses

Avg. Sustained Write Speed 120MB/s
Avg. Sequential Write Speed 309MB/s
